insidious
adj.
beguiling but harmful
"insidious pleasures"
intended to entrap
working or spreading in a hidden and usually injurious way
"glaucoma is an insidious disease"
同义词:pernicioussubtle

insidious (adj.)
1540s, from Middle French insidieux (15c.) or directly from Latin insidiosus "deceitful, cunning, artful," from insidiae (plural) "plot, snare, ambush," from insidere "sit on, occupy," from in- "in" (see in- (2)) + sedere "to sit" (see sedentary). Related: Insidiously; insidiousness.
